Eligibility of college librarian-
1. Inter college- B.Lib. + experience
2. PG college - M.Lib. + experience
Eligibility of University Asst. Librarian-
M.Phil./Ph.d. +NET+ experience

and only M.Phil. holders don't eligible for the post of Uni.Asst. Librarian

as per new circular of ugc for college librarian phd/net is compulsory.and for univ asst.lib also should have phd or net. net compulsory for mphil candidate. delhi university colleges follewing this circular see tha various jobs of librarians in delhi univ colleges librarian. recently see the 21st april employement news there is a job of librarian in swami shraddhanand college, delhi. there is specialy mentioned net compulsory for mphil.
